Our first Boxer, Buddy (now at the Bridge) was actually named Budweiser. When he came into our home as a pup, unnamed, we had a hard time agreeing on what this little guy should be called. My husband was picking the more macho type names, I thinking that once he grew up, people might be intimidated by him, figured he deserved a friendlier name. Our son was home from college, we were sitting outside and my son was drinking a beer. All of a sudden he said "Let's call him Budweiser! We thought about it, and agreed, Budweiser aka Buddy. Buddy is the name that stuck, we only called him Budweiser when he was in trouble, or if we wanted his immediate attention. I tended to call him Babe more than anything, and he did answer to my call for Babe.

Kailee came to us as a rescue, already named by her previous home. I thought the name a tad bit unusual, thought about changing it, but for some reason Kailee suits her, She is a true Miss Kailee. I do tend to call her Missy a fair bit, and she does answer to Missy.

Clyde came to us as a rescue as well, already named by his previous home. What can I say, He is a true blue Clyde aka Clod (You see he isn't always very graceful) I find although hubby always calls him Clyde, I without thinking call him My Little Bambino and if I call Bambino he comes to me

Dixie's full name is 'Precious Dixie Diana'
Precious was part of her mother's name....My hubby just liked the name Dixie....and Diana is in honor of Princess Diana, whom I admired

Brittany's full name is 'Buddy's LiL' Tiger Brittany'
Buddy is her father's name
LiL' Tiger....she is a brendle and looked like a little tiger when we got her
Brittany is because my hubby used to be a fan of Britney Spears :rolleyes: (Notice I wouldn't let him spell it the same ;) )

Mabelline.....She got her name because she is a White boxer with a splash of fawn and black across one eye that looks like eye shadow

Maggie Mae....Hubby always wanted to name one of our babies Maggie


We also have an AKC registered Dalmatian
Skylar.....his full name is 'Sir Skylar Lotzadots'
On our way to pick up Skylar....we passed a small community named Schyler....I liked the name but didn't care for the spelling..so that part was changed. If you could see him, you would definitely know why part of his name is Lotzadots :D

Madison is named from the movie "Splash". We were looking at all the movies in our collection. We wanted to name her TaTonka but I just couldn't see myself outside yelling TaTonka, TaTonka :o (from the movie Dances with Wolves).

Carson was named because his legs were bowed a little and his chest was so big as a pup that he looked like a old gun fighter and the name Carson just fit. Not to mention it sounds good with Madison.

Boru was a rescue dog, already named when I got him. The rescue people were into history and named him after a 15th century king of Ireland, Brian Boru. I liked it, so he got to keep it. kingicon

Caesar is named after Caesar's Palace in Vegas. My hubby is a gambler and I can't win anything but the week before we were to pick up Caesar we were out there and I won some good money at Caesar's. We figured on keeping the luck with us and naming the puppy Caesar. Up until then the breeder was calling him Greta's Runty. NO way was that staying with him! He's still a runt but boy does he like to try his luck with us!

Gnarly's full name is Bocien Justice in June. This is his registered name which is actually picked by the breeder so we had nothing to do with that, the breeder actually called him Judge, as a puppy and his brother was Jury. (We didn't know he was Judge til after we had named him, because Judge would have fitted him nicely)

When we were thinking of names I liked Marley and my boyfriend said yeah thats GNARLY really sarcastically. And after that every time we spoke about getting the new puppy we kept saying GNARLY so it just stuck. It's different and most people comment on it.
